Biography

Emilio Estévez (born May 12, 1962) is an American actor and filmmaker. Estevez started his career as a member of the acting Brat Pack of the 1980s, appearing in The Breakfast Club, St. Elmo's Fire, and The Outsiders. He is also known for the films Repo Man, The Mighty Ducks, Stakeout, Maximum Overdrive, Bobby (which he also wrote and directed), and Young Guns. He is the son of actor Martin Sheen and the older brother of Charlie Sheen.
